A member asked:

I'm waist training. i wear a waist shaper some days. are they safe?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Chris Faubel answered

Specializes in Pain Management

Waist training?: If you mean training to slim down you waist and build a good strong core, then i'd have a suggest not using a waist shaper. Elastic waist shapers can artificially support your spine and therefore takes away the need for your own core muscles (abdomen and low back). This only leads to weaker muscles. If you're just wearing a shaper to go out on a date or getting dressed up one evening, go for it.
